    To comment on the implementation of this initiative, I wan't to insist again that it should be supported by some in-game mechanics.

    At this time, I would say 90 % of the game-mechanic is hack'n slash oriented (PvM, PvP, you see what I mean). And the remaining 10 % is emote, some nice places to gather and fun items. This is was is called "RPG" in AO.
    Sorry but I do not consider the forums as a RPG tool. I'm not playing mmoFORUMS, I'm playing AO. Forums should support RPG, not drive it.

    So 10 % is not enough to call AO a mmoRPG as RPG stands for Role Playing Game.

    To give you an example: I've been in this game for almost 2,5 years now. In the early age of my character, I attended a nice omni RP meeting. It was at a nice location. We had people who were guarding the place checking people iD and doing patrols. We had nice speakers who scripted their speech (was awesome).
    2 years after that, we have Notum Wars (killing things), Shadowlands (killing things), Alien Invasion (killing things).
    No new game mechanic to support RP. We are still stuck with our emotes, forums and that's all.

    As I don't like to critizice and not make proposal, here are possible exemples (all have been proposed already I think):
    - it should be possible to afiliate your guild to an Omni-department. This should be visible In Game
    - affiliating your guild to an omni-department could be a quest in itself. As a consequence, being affiliated to a department could have a minor benefit or some RP items available to those department only (ex: cop insign for Omni-Pol, special vehicule for omni-transport).
    - you should be able to access your omni-department building or omni-administrative HQ
    - players could be assigned a position in the hierarchy with some benefits attached to that (access to specific area in omni-administration building, special items like specific neck items so show your position in the hierarchy).

    I think that if RPG want to have a place in AO (I do think so otherwise you guys from FC wouldn't have called this mmoRPG but mmoHack'n Slash) there should be game elements implemented to support that.
    RPG should not rely on the motivation on some players really dedicated to create some RPG events with what they can but RPG should be a motivation in it-self in a game supporting it and rewarding it.

    My comment about RPG In-Game mechanics is nothing new. All this has already be discussed multiples times and those ideas sent to FC by people more involved in RP than me.

    I just wanted to stress the point that unlike PvM/PvP where you are only collecting xp / sk (sorry for this shortcut), Roleplaying means you can interact with your environment and clearly have an impact on it on the long term.

    AO and other games are called MMORPGs because you just simply farm xp and spend them in a character sheet afterwards. That's all.

    While playing, I'm somestimes frustrated as I really have the impression that you have the players on one side and then the world on the other side and both sides are not really communicating with each other and have minimal connections.

    This is why I'm really interested in this initiative but hope this will only be a first movement of AO story toward the players.
    You greenies can't run all over the place to organize or watch over events, this is why I really think some In-Game mechanics should support this. That way playing could run their own events and have the feeling we can really have an impact on the live on rubi-ka.

    ex: a "side" score could be calculated every month based on the number of notum controller for each faction + number of faction quest successfully accomplished. Then evolution of the conflict based on who won this round in term of score.

    An example of faction quest could be:
    1. All players, through a quest can be granted a position in one (and only one) omni-department.
    2. example of OTAF simple mission (automaticaly generated): an omni- transport crashed in WW. All players affiliated to OTAF who are online at this moment receive a message telling them their presence is required in WW to protect its content. The surroundings are heavily guarded by aliens. Mission is: kill all the aliens. Reward: 100 Omni-faction points (which could be spent to obtain a higher position in the hierarchy or on special items).
    3. example of OTAF colonel mission (you earned you colonel rank via those faction missions): you receive a mission that a Clan outpost is menacing an omni notum mine (automaticaly generated). You can then send a message to all OTAF soldier to invite them for a raid on this outpost. At the end of the raid, you earn 7 promotion letters which you can distribute to the selected players who took part to this raid (promition letter = +100 omni faction, destroyed after use).
    High ranked players could organize more complex missions with greenies.

    All this is very basic RPG but could be highly motivating for all players.

    I just wanted to stress the point that unlike PvM/PvP where you are only collecting xp / sk (sorry for this shortcut), Roleplaying means you can interact with your environment and clearly have an impact on it on the long term.
    And yet, all the missions you suggest are "Kill the aliens at coordinates X,Y" or "Kill the clanners at coordinates X,Y." There has to be something else to do.
    We already have events similar to these from time to time, with the Dust Brigade attacking different cities, and aliens attacking the main cities. Unfortunately most of these have very little to do with roleplay, and quickly become nothing more than a normal raid in a different location.



    AO and other games are called MMORPGs because you just simply farm xp and spend them in a character sheet afterwards. That's all.
    This is hardly true. Well, maybe for the non-RPers. Maybe even for you.
    Would I be correct in assuming you didn't participate in the Newland Guard Initiative, weren't around for the reformation of the Council of Truth, etc.?

    Don't get me wrong, it's fun to have combat events from time to time, but there needs to be a reason behind them--and it's more fun to talk with Ross or Radiman face to face than it is hearing a planetwide announcement.
